  • Abstract
    Although information technology (IT) is being applied to various aspects of construction projects during their lifecycle, there is a need for an integrated IT system so that authorized users can record, view, query and update information when needed. Through analyzing key issues of project management over project lifecycle, this paper proposed a conceptual framework of information modeling for construction projects (PIM) . The framework consists of three key components in a network-based environment: (1) a master data management system; (2) a project information portal (PIP); and (3) a various number of applications. A successful PIM system would provide a representation of the project process to facilitate exchange and interoperability of information in digital format.
